Are Delta-9 THC Drinks Allowed? Missouri's Stance

Missouri has recently become a central point in the legalization of cannabis. However, when it comes to Delta-9 THC beverages, the regulations are a bit murky.

While recreational marijuana is now legal, the status of Delta-9 THC drinks remains somewhat debatable. Some argue that because cannabis edibles are allowed, Delta-9 THC beverages should be too. Others suggest that the distinct nature of beverages requires more review.

Currently, Missouri's cannabis regulatory agency are still working clear standards for Delta-9 THC beverages. This suggests that businesses wanting to sell these products must exercise extreme diligence.

It's important to stay informed of the latest developments in Missouri cannabis law. Consulting a legal professional who specializes in cannabis is always the safest way to ensure you are adhering to all applicable laws and regulations.

Missouri's Cannabis Boom: Exploring the Legal Landscape of THC Drinks

Since Missouri voters legalized recreational cannabis in 2022, the Show-Me State has been witnessing a surge in cannabis enthusiasts. Amidst this growing trend, THC drinks are emerging as a favorite choice for consumers seeking a subtle cannabis experience. From sparkling waters infused with hemp extract to craft cocktails containing THC-infused syrups, the market is exploding with innovative options.

However, navigating this new legal landscape can be confusing. Regulations surrounding THC drinks in Missouri are still emerging, and understanding the concentration of these products is vital for a safe and enjoyable experience.

  • The state has implemented strict rules on THC content in beverages, aiming to minimize the risk of overconsumption.
  • Producers must clearly display THC content and other relevant information on their products.
  • Consumers are recommended to start with a minimal dose and gradually increase it as needed.

As the market matures, we can expect more widespread clarity on THC drink regulations. In the meantime, Missouri residents are exploring this novel trend with a mix of excitement, contributing to the state's evolving cannabis culture.
